NNL Super 8: Gombe United, Kogi United Share Point As Bosso Blames Poor Finishing for Draw

Gombe United played out a 1-1 draw with Kogi United in Sunday’s opening game of the Nigeria National League (NNL) Super Eight tournament at the Enyimba international stadium reports Completesports.com.

Joseph Onoja gave Gombe United an early lead in the second-minute goal but parity was restored two minutes after the hour mark through Ibrahim Enesi.

Gombe United manager, Ladan Bosso was extremely disappointed at his side’s inability to convert the numerous scoring chances created by his team in the encounter.

Abdulazeez Yusuff and striker Adamu Mohammed had clear-cut chances to put the game beyond Kogi United but missed their opportunities.

“We were not able to get the three points because we were too wasteful in the goal mouth of the opponent,” Bosso said during his post-match interview.

“Gombe United are a team with the quality for the Premier League and with what we have done so far, it remains just to work on the finishing.”

“That is what we are to do as coaches, to watch the strengths and weaknesses of the team and work on the aspects. Improve on the weaknesses and equally improve the aspect of strengths.”

“You could see Kogi United were even celebrating the draw because they know we were not evenly matched but because we were wasteful in the goalmouth that’s why it happened.

“We will identify the problems in this first match and work on them against the next match.”

Gombe will face Real Stars FC in their second group game on Monday.

Meanwhile, in the second game ongoing at the Enyimba International stadium, Insurance of Benin are currently leading ten man Delta Stars 2-0 as at the time of this report.

Delta Stars defender Nduka Eze was sent off after 35 minutes.

Charles Omokaro and Michael Enaruna scored for Bendel Insurance.

Kada City will face Real Stars in the third game while Remo Stars will battle Shooting Stars of Ibadan in the final fixture for the day. Both games will kick off by 4pm and 6pm respectively.
